The Search for the Sword - Voting Thread!

Hello everyone!

The Second Global Contest of the Lands of Classic Castle project is drawing to a close. But before we can officialy end, we need a winner! And who would be better fit to select this winner but YOU!

For the non-LCC members, let me first clarify. The challenge of this contest was based around an old story of an enchanted sword, lost in the lands of the LCC. The participant had to create two MOC's, one finding clues that would lead him/her to the sword, and the other would show him/her finding it. Voting!

The winner of this challenge will be chosen by the members of the Classic-Castle community. That means that non LCC-members can vote too! That's right, you ALL have a say!

Take a look at the entries, than vote for the one you think is best in the other voting thread. There are a few rules, however.

1. The finalists are allowed to vote, but please don't vote for yourself.
2. You may only vote once (obviously).
3. To prevent fraud, CC-members with less than 5 posts are NOT allowed to vote.

Voting will end Next Saturday. (The 1st of September 2012. )

Cast your vote! Participants good luck!
